LAFCO approves Navigant contract for CCA risk assessment amid stakeholder objections
Summary
LAFCO voted to award a contract to Navigant for a risk assessment and term sheet to support Clean Power SF procurement. Public commenters and some advocates expressed concern about Navigant's methodology and urged LAFCO to bid all 17 tasks together; commissioners said oversight and peer review will guard against undesired outcomes.
The Local Agency Formation Commission voted at its April meeting to approve a contract with Navigant to perform a risk assessment and to develop a term sheet that will guide the Clean Power SF RFP.
